## Bug Description

In AKS Desktop, the Pods view does not show a toggle/option to view the remaining pods when many pods are present. I provisioned 20 pods, but I can only see a subset and cannot access the rest.

## Steps to Reproduce

1. Open AKS Desktop on macOS.
2. Navigate to **Workloads > Pods**.
3. Provision or ensure there are around 20 pods in the cluster.
4. Observe the Pods list view.

## Expected Behavior

There should be a visible toggle, pagination control, or scroll mechanism to view all pods (including remaining pods beyond the initially visible list).

## Actual Behavior

Only part of the pod list is visible, and there is no visible toggle/control to view the remaining pods.

## Screenshots

Image

## Environment

- **Kubernetes Version**: 1.25.0
- **Azure CLI Version**: 2.87.0
- **Browser**: Not applicable (AKS Desktop app)
- **OS**: macOS
- **AKS Desktop Version**: 0.7.0

## Additional Context

This issue makes it difficult to monitor all running pods in larger workloads.
